I noticed three "big" changes.
#1. Riptide is being put on PTR. Ripetide (Rank 4... assuming level 80) Instant Cast. 6s Cooldown. 18% Base mana. Heals a friendly target for 764 to 826 and another 795 over 15s. Your next Chain Heal cast on that primary target within 15s will consume the healing over time effect and increase the amount of the Chain Heal by 25%. Basically this is what had been told to us by the dev's. We'll see if it sucks or not.
#2. Earthliving HoT Change. This one is a biggie IMHO. Blessing of the Eternals 2/2 is Increase the Critical Effect chance of your spells by 4%, and increase the chance to apply the earthliving heal over time effect by 80% when they are at or under 35% total health. Earthliving already has a 20% chance... meaning we're at 100%! Not only is it a guaranteed hot for low health people PROC'd from our heals... but that also means it won't just be flying around on people with 100% health overhealing (except for the random 20% procs anyways... but who cares now).
#3. Flame Shock Range Increase. Lava Flows 3/3. Increase the range of your Flame Shock by 15 yards (5 yards each point) and increase the critical strike damage bonus of your lava burst by 24% (8% each point). This means RANGE-WISE, lava burst-flame shock-lightning bolt rotation is at least possible. Damage-wise, I don't know... but at least it has theoretical possibilities now.
